Analysis on the Limitation of PMD Compensator in the 10Gbps Transmission System with Polarization Dependent Loss

Abstract

We analyze the effects of PDL in the high-speed transmission system, under the PMD compensation environment. As the link PDL increases, the BER enhancement from the PMD compensator decreases sharply, making the PMD compensation technique much ineffective. Analysis with an 80km, 10Gbps system shows that even a minute link PDL of 0.5dB could seriously limit the system performance.
